Understanding Coinbase Commerce

Coinbase Commerce is a payment gateway that enables merchants to receive payments in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), and many other cryptocurrencies. It integrates seamlessly with WooCommerce, allowing you to set up cryptocurrency payments quickly without needing any technical skills.

While Coinbase Commerce offers a user-friendly interface for integrating crypto payments into your store, it also comes with several drawbacks:

  • Fees: Coinbase Commerce charges 1.49% per transaction, which can add up quickly when processing multiple transactions.
  • Hold Times: Payments may be held for up to three business days before being released into your wallet.
  • Limited Token Support: While it supports major cryptocurrencies like BTC and ETH, the list of supported tokens is not as extensive compared to XPayr.
